ABOUT THE COMPANY
State government agency responsible in making Queensland safer. Currently seeking a Senior Talent Acquisition Advisor to join their busy team for a temporary assignment until end of September 2024.
Responsibilities:
ABOUT THE ROLE
As a Senior Talent Acquisition Advisor, you will foster best practice recruitment and selection processes through coordination and analysis of various activities. In addition, your key duties are as follow:
- Manage, coordinate and complete the end-to-end recruitment and selection processes of staff
- Undertake all recruitment related activities ensuring alignment with best practice for recruitment service
- Act as the point of contact for the resolution of applicant queries
- Liaise with stakeholders in order to understand the structure, policies
- Review and analyses applications and draft correspondence to applicants as required.
To be successful in this role, you must have:
- You will ideally have experience in Human Resource Recruitment and management
- You will have strong leadership skills
- You will have excellent communication and interpersonal skills
- You will have intermediate to high level of IT skills
- You will have a high attention to detail and the ability to prioritise competing deadlines
